What it's like to work here

Reporting to the Head Gardener, you'll be joining a close-knit team, with a wonderful sense of community.

Cliveden's Italianate mansion, riverside setting and family-friendly events, draw visitors in all year round, making this property a busy location with a wide range of opportunities. There is always plenty to do at the 375-acre estate, with conservation of the water garden ponds among recent projects.

There are a series of impressive formal gardens with far-reaching views, an abundance of bedding change throughout the seasons and an intimate Rose Garden for those wanting a little bit of peace and tranquillity.
